Handset Registration With Your ClearSounds A50

The following steps are for registration of additional handsets (model A50E):

1.Make sure the ClearSounds A50 base unit is connected into the AC outlet and phone jack. Your ClearSounds A50 handset will show HS-1(Handset 1) on the LCD.

2.Press and hold the • /PAGE button on the base unit. After 3 seconds, press the "CH" button on the handset until you get a beep and the display will read HS-2.

3.If you have more than two handsets, press the "CH" button on the handset until you get a beep and the display reads HS-3.Release the • /PAGE button from the base.

NOTE: The • /PAGE button on the base unit should be kept pressed during the whole procedure.

Headset Operation

Your A50E handset is equipped with a 2.5mm headset jack for use with an optional acces- sory headset for hands-free operation. If you choose to use the headset option, you must obtain an optional accessory headset, which is compatible with the handset.
